An Alarm Item is essentially an alarm. It needs to be bonded to a numerical tag to monitor the variation range.

When opening the Alarm environment, the Items tab will load - by default only some of the columns will appear, with the basic Item configuration. By right-clicking on the header table you can see and check the other available columns.

The Alarms Items properties provide detailed configuration settings for individual alarms. This includes the unique identifier, condition specifications, value thresholds, associations to groups or hierarchies, and auxiliary data. Metadata such as creation and modification dates are also included to track changes over time. Messages and comments can be embedded to deliver relevant information during an alarm event.

Alarm Items Properties

ID

Unique identifier for the alarm item.

VersionID

Version identifier associated with the alarm item.

TagName

Name of the tag being monitored for alarm events.

Condition

Condition that triggers the alarm.

Limit

Predefined threshold for the alarm.

Limit1

Secondary threshold value.

Limit2

Tertiary threshold value.

Disable

Option to enable/disable the alarm.

Deadband

Range in which changes are ignored.

Setpoint

Desired target value.

SetpointDeadband

Range around setpoint where changes are ignored.

Group

Group to which the alarm item belongs.

Area

Area designation for alarm management.

Priority

Priority level of the alarm.

AuxValue

Auxiliary value associated with the alarm.

AuxValue2

Secondary auxiliary value.

AuxValue3

Tertiary auxiliary value.

TemplateID

Template identifier linked with the alarm.

LockState

Current lock status of the alarm item.

LockOwner

User or system that locked the item.

DateModified

Date the alarm item was last modified.

DateCreated

Date the alarm item was created.

XRefInfo

Cross-reference information for the alarm.

Comment

Comments or notes related to the alarm item.

Message

Alarm message displayed upon triggering. It enables that a message to appear to the user when an alarm is triggered.
